A composite symbol is created by combining which types of symbols?

Explanation:
A composite symbol is formed by combining basic symbols. In schematic notation, basic symbols represent fundamental electrical components or functions, such as resistors, capacitors, or switches. By combining these basic symbols, a more complex entity, or composite symbol, is created, representing a more intricate circuit or system. The process of creating composite symbols allows for a clear and organized representation of more extensive systems while retaining the functionality and clarity of the individual components involved. Understanding this relationship is crucial for interpreting and creating schematics effectively.

Exam Format

The TPC Schematic and Symbols Test typically consists of multiple-choice questions designed to evaluate your proficiency in identifying and understanding a variety of schematic symbols. The exam includes:

  • 40 multiple-choice questions
  • Each question presents a diagram or a symbol with accompanying possible answers
  • Test duration is generally 90 minutes

The complexity of the questions can vary, and the exam is aimed at testing your ability to correctly interpret different types of schematics and symbols across various contexts.

What to Expect on the Exam

You can expect the TPC Schematic and Symbols Test to cover a wide range of topics related to schematic symbols including:

  • Electrical circuit diagrams
  • Various symbol categories such as wires, connectors, and resistors
  • Reading and interpreting complex electrical schematics
  • Identification of industry-standard symbols and acronyms

This comprehensive coverage ensures a thorough assessment of your understanding and ability to apply schematic design principles in real-world situations.
